Factors to Consider When Choosing Robotic Lawn Mower With Replaceable Blades
When selecting a robotic lawn mower with replaceable blades, consider your yard’s size, terrain, and how much automation you desire. Key factors include navigation technology—whether RTK, AI vision, or auto-mapping—and setup complexity. For small, flat yards, visual navigation models like the YARDCARE V100 may suffice. Larger or more complex yards benefit from RTK or AI obstacle avoidance, as seen in models like the ANTHBOT M9 or WORX Landroid. Long-term blade support, ease of boundary creation, and app control are also critical for a hassle-free experience.Yard Size and Terrain
Matching your lawn size with the mower’s coverage area is vital. For small yards, simple visual navigation models are often enough. Larger, sloped, or obstacle-rich lawns require advanced navigation like RTK or AI vision, which ensures thorough and precise coverage without manual intervention. Consider slope capacity and obstacle detection features to prevent mishaps and ensure safety.
Navigation Technology
RTK offers high precision without wires, ideal for complex or multi-zone lawns. AI vision and auto-mapping provide flexible, obstacle-aware mowing, especially useful in yards with many garden features. Simpler models with basic sensors are suitable for straightforward, flat yards but may struggle with obstacles or slopes.
Setup and Maintenance
Models with virtual boundaries or magnetic strips are easier to set up but may be less flexible. RTK-based models require technical installation but offer long-term reliability. Consider how often you’ll need to replace blades and whether the mower supports easy access for maintenance—this can influence your overall satisfaction and costs over time.
Frequently Asked Questions
Can robotic lawn mowers with replaceable blades handle slopes?
Yes, many advanced models like the ANTHBOT M9 and WORX Landroid can handle slopes up to 30-45%. This capability depends on the specific slope capacity listed in the specs. If your yard has significant inclines, choose a model with a higher slope rating to ensure safe and thorough mowing without slipping or missing spots.
Do I need perimeter wires for these robotic mowers?
It depends on the model. Some, like the ECOVACS Goat O1000 and ANTHBOT M9, do not require perimeter wires thanks to RTK and vision navigation. Others, like the YARDCARE V100, use magnetic strips for boundary creation, which is simpler but less flexible. If you prefer a wire-free setup, look for models emphasizing RTK or AI vision technology.
How often do I need to replace the blades on these robotic mowers?
Blade replacement frequency varies based on usage and model. The ECOVACS Goat O1000 includes 36 extra blades, supporting longer intervals between replacements. Models with more durable or longer-lasting blades reduce maintenance costs and downtime, making blade support an important factor for long-term planning.
Are these robotic mowers suitable for complex yards with many obstacles?
Yes, models like the WORX Landroid Vision Cloud and ANTHBOT M9 are equipped with advanced obstacle detection—AI sensors, vision systems, and obstacle avoidance algorithms—making them capable of navigating intricate yard features safely. Simpler models may struggle with dense obstacles or uneven terrain.
